7020 Aluminum vs. 360.0 Aluminum

Both 7020 aluminum and 360.0 aluminum are aluminum alloys. They have 89% of their average alloy composition in common.

For each property being compared, the top bar is 7020 aluminum and the bottom bar is 360.0 aluminum.
